ch and Debate team finished its "best season ever" last weekend, advisor John Petti said, with two students earning the honor of state champion and the team finishing fourth among the 42 high schools competing at the state speech competition.
Joann King was the state champion in Dramatic Interpretation while Marissa Aiken was the state champion in Expository Speaking.
King and Aiken are the second and third state champions ever from Mountain Home High School.
